If you value teamwork, empowerment in your career, and are eager to champion innovative and sustainable solutions to our clients, this opportunity just may be for you! **Job Description** This position serves as a Project Material Manager on small- to medium-sized Engineering, Procurement, Fabrication, and Construction (EPFC) projects, or as a Project Procurement Manager on medium- to large-sized EPFC projects, if necessary, or as the functional lead for global indirect procurement in support of office facilities and overhead departments. This role has key responsibilities for critical supplier negotiations. • Provide technical and administrative direction related to the established Company, Material Management, and/or project policies and procedures • Responsible for the implementation, management, and monitoring of the Material Management Work Process with the approved Corporate Reference Tool for Material Management to meet project requirements and schedule • Plan, organize, direct, and control the material management discipline or global indirect function execution • Advocate the use of the Material Management knowledge management portals and communities • Maintain effective client relationships through client service excellence in execution • Prepare and issue relevant Material Management reports • Other duties as assigned **Basic Job Requirements** • Accredited four (4) year degree or global equivalent in applicable field of study and twelve (12) years of work-related experience or a combination of education and directly related experience equal to sixteen (16) years if non-degreed; some locations may have additional or different qualifications in order to comply with local requirements • Ability to communicate effectively with audiences that include but are not limited to management, coworkers, clients, vendors, contractors, and other stakeholders • Job related technical knowledge necessary to complete the job • Ability to learn and apply knowledge of applicable local, state/province, and federal/national statutes and guidelines • Ability to attend to detail and work in a time-conscious and time-effective manner **Other Job Requirements** • Proactively manage change • Act responsively and timely **Preferred Qualifications** • Accredited degree or global equivalent • Applicable professional certification(s) or license(s) • Experience should be primarily in the area of material management •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ills • Excellent computer literacy and skills • Excellent leadership and decision-making skills Fluor Canada rewards hard work, knowledge, and commitment.
